Many children are naturally drawn to the vibrant characters and exciting adventures of superheroes. Leveraging this innate fascination can significantly enhance their English language acquisition. These songs aren't just about entertainment; they offer a multifaceted approach to learning, incorporating various aspects of language development:
1. Vocabulary Expansion: Superhero songs often introduce new vocabulary related to powers, actions, and settings. Words like "superstrength," "flying," "invincible," "rescue," and "villain" become easily memorable within the context of a catchy tune. Repeated exposure to these words through singing and listening reinforces their understanding and retention.
2. Pronunciation Improvement: Singing along to these songs helps children improve their pronunciation. The rhythmic nature of music aids in mastering intonation, stress patterns, and individual sounds. The repetitive nature of lyrics also allows for consistent practice, enhancing their ability to produce clear and accurate English sounds.
3. Grammar Acquisition: Many superhero songs subtly incorporate grammatical structures. Through listening and repetition, children gradually internalize sentence structures, tenses, and prepositions. This passive learning is often more effective than direct grammar instruction, particularly for younger children.
4. Enhanced Listening Comprehension: Understanding the lyrics requires active listening, a crucial skill for language acquisition. The engaging nature of the songs keeps children attentive, encouraging them to focus on the meaning and nuances of the English language.
5. Increased Confidence and Engagement: Superhero themes are inherently motivating. Children feel empowered and excited to learn when the subject matter aligns with their interests. This positive association with learning fosters a sense of confidence and encourages active participation.

Tips for Effective Use:
* Make it interactive: Encourage children to sing along, dance, and act out the lyrics.
* Use visuals: Pair the songs with videos or flashcards to reinforce vocabulary and comprehension.
* Repeat and review: Regular exposure is key. Play the songs repeatedly, allowing children to gradually master the lyrics and vocabulary.
* Contextualize the learning: Incorporate the songs into storytelling, role-playing, and other activities to deepen their understanding and engagement.
* Cater to individual learning styles: Some children may benefit from visual aids, while others might prefer active participation. Adapt your approach to suit their needs.
